Nature of request
Ingham requests that he be restored to his manors of Codford and Avon, which he was forced to lease to the bishop of Exeter by his mastery and power. He was sent to Gascony soon after and has not been able to sue his case.
Nature of endorsement
He should sue at the common law.

Note
The guard note seems to misdate this petition to c. 1324 on the basis of the licence granted to Ingham to grant the manors to the bishop (CPR 1321-4, p.395). As the petition makes clear, the petitioner was forced to do this, and then was out of the country in the king's service, so that the petition is likely to be some little time after this. Indeed, as the petition is so openly critical of the bishop of Exeter, it seems likely that the petition actually dates to 1327 or thereafter following the murder of the bishop in 1326.
